Got the Kamikaze special and it hit the spot! I felt the $12.95 price was a great deal. The roll featured yellowtail inside and a variety of fish on top Salmon, Tuna and Yellowtail. I think the service here is great, the ladies during lunch hour were very kind and sweet. The interior could use a bit of renovation, but didn't bother me too much. I remember coming here a lot in 2006-08 and now it's 2025. I'm sure they'll do some upgrades soon. Nonetheless still cozy and tasty food. Plus outdoor seating. Cheers!

We used to go to this place not only for their rolls but also for their Pork Katsu Curry. We were not disappointed. It has one of the best Pork Katsu Curry in San Diego. The Pork Katsu Curry with 3 rolls almost fit our $50 date budget except that we ordered an additional Calamari appetizer. So our total bill reached $60. Why did we order extra Calamari, because the pork in their Pork Katsu Curry was not enough to finish all the rice that came with it. Perhaps they should add more meat. So I'm giving our total experience 4 stars only.
